Immigrants from Portugal vs Immigrants from Costa Rica Median Family Income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 174,753,640 people shows a moderate neg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Portugal and median family income in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.471 and weighted average of $100,984.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 204,217,887 people shows a slight posit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Costa Rica and median family income in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.092 and weighted average of $101,354, a difference of 0.37%.
